| Chemical Composition | Content (%) |
|---|---|
| Nickel (Ni) | 42–46 |
| Chromium (Cr) | 19.5–22.5 |
| Molybdenum (Mo) | 2.5–3.5 |
| Copper (Cu) | 1.5–3.0 |
| Titanium (Ti) | 1.9–2.4 |
| Aluminum (Al) | 0.1–0.5 |
| Iron (Fe) | Balance |
| Physical Properties | Value |
| ------------------------- | ----------- |
| Density | 8.08 g/cm³ |
| Melting Range | 1315–1345°C |
| Yield Strength (aged) | 724–758 MPa |
| Tensile Strength | ≥930 MPa |
| Elongation | ≥20% |

1. Material Selection
We get high quality nickel, chromium and molybdenum from approved vendors. The chemical composition is checked before melting.
2. Melting under vacuum
Homogeneous ingots are produced in electric arc furnaces in regulated atmospheres. This removes the contaminants that cause it to be brittle.
3. Hot-Extrusion
Hot billets are perforated and extruded via mandrels to produce seamless tubing. No welding = consistent wall thickness.
4. Cold Pilgrimage
The final proportions and an improved surface polish are obtained via precision cold working. Your tubes are ready to connect.
5. Solution Annealing
The tubes are heated to 1775°F (968°C) then immediately cooled. This dissolves precipitates and prepares it for age hardening.
6.Age hardening (precipitation hardening)
Maximum strength is obtained by aging at 1300oF (704oC) for 8 hours with production of titanium and aluminum carbide.
7. Final Inspection
Every tube passes ultrasonic testing, eddy current inspection, and hydrostatic pressure testing before shipment.

Q: What's the difference between Incoloy 825 and Incoloy 925?
A: Incoloy 925 is age hardenable, and may be heat treated to reach greater strength. Incoloy 825 has high corrosion resistance but cannot be precipitation hardened to improve mechanical strength.
Q. Do you have a NACE MR0175 sour service compliant tube?
A: Yes. The heat treatment procedure we use guarantees the material satisfies the hardness and corrosion resistance standards of NACE MR0175/ISO 15156. Full compliance documentation available.
Q: Can these tubes be welded successfully?
A: Seamless tubes do not have any weld seams. If joining is required, utilize filler metals such as Inconel 725 or 625. With proper heat treatment before and after welding, corrosion resistance and strength is maintained.
